Are you looking for things to do in Bournemouth or Poole that will make you feel festive? Learn how to make a five-foot-tall Christmas obelisk out of willow.

You'll be trying your hand at this fun and relaxing activity all guided by your experienced weaving teacher. they will help you pick up some simple weaving techniques using the weaving materials provided, including a variety of natural and dyed willow.

Explore the selection of willow decorations your teacher brings with them. From hoops, stars, reindeer and trees there are all sorts of ways to add a touch of Christmas to the willow garden obelisk you create.

Using the weaving skills you have learned, you can then use the prepared willow included to create even more amazing handmade Christmas decorations. Use them around the home or give them to loved ones as a special handmade gift.

Using traditional methods to create contemporary design Green Spiral Willow is all about using willow to create stunning woven items.

Green Spiral Willow was created by Yanina Stockings. After growing up in the highlands of Scotland, she was surrounded by the ancient Caledonian pine forest where she takes a lot of inspiration. She has a BSc Hons in conservation and sustainability is very important to her.

All the willow and rush supplied in her classes are sourced from the south of England and she tries to harvest her own locally. This helps her bring the ancient rural craft of weaving to everyone in an eco-friendly way!
